将字符追加到PHP输出

时间:2018-07-24 19:01:56

标签: php

我有一个简单的问题。

  echo "<tr>"; 
  echo "<td>" . $row['Rep'] . "</td>"; 
  echo "</tr>";

假设上面的代码片段输出“ 1”。如何在上面的代码中在其前面附加一个点.?这样输出将是.1而不是1。我在网络上找不到类似的示例,因此我决定在这里询问。谢谢!

3 个答案:

答案 0 :(得分:1)

喜欢

echo '<tr><td>.' . $row['Rep'] . '</td></tr>';

答案 1 :(得分:1)

  echo "<tr>"; 
  echo "<td>" . "." . $row['Rep'] . "</td>"; 
  echo "</tr>";

或者如果不是1

  echo "<tr>"; 
  echo "<td>" . ($row['Rep'] == 1 ? "." . $row['Rep'] : $row['Rep']) . "</td>"; 
  echo "</tr>";

答案 2 :(得分:0)

$row_rep_val = ".".$row['Rep'];
echo '<tr> 
<td>'.str_replace($row_rep_val, $row['Rep'],$row['Rep']).'</td>
 </tr>';

输出:1